What Are French Doors?
French doors are double doors that are typically made from glass and are hinged, permitting them to open inwards or outwards. They are often utilized to link living areas to outdoor patios, gardens, or verandas. The addition of sidelights improves their visual appeal and performance, offering a seamless transition between inside and outdoors.
Advantages of French Doors with Side Windows
French doors with sidelights offer numerous advantages:

Natural Light: The big glass panes in French doors, combined with the side windows, permit an abundance of natural light to flood into the home, lightening up any area.

Visual Appeal: The classic design adds beauty, making it a popular choice among homeowners looking to enhance their home's exterior and interior design.

Increased Ventilation: Opening both the French doors and the sidelights can enhance air flow, enhancing indoor air quality.

Improved Views: These doors grant unblocked views of the outdoor environment, making them ideal for homes with beautiful landscaping or scenic environments.

Increased Property Value: Installing elegant French doors with sidelights can improve the overall worth of a home, appealing to possible buyers.
Style Options for French Doors with Side Windows
French Door With Side Windows doors with sidelights can be found in various designs, configurations, and products. Below are popular options:
1. Material OptionsMaterialProsConsWoodClassic appeal, exceptional insulationHigher maintenance, more costlyVinylLow upkeep, energy-efficientRestricted color optionsFiberglassResilient, energy-efficient, very little upkeepCan be more priceyAluminumLightweight, modern-day visualLess insulation, vulnerable to glare2. Design StylesStandard: Characterized by detailed detailing and ornamental moldings; suitable for traditional home designs. Modern: Clean lines and minimalistic styles appeal to modern aesthetics. French Country: Rustic beauty with distressed surfaces that add character to country-style homes.Craftsman: Emphasizing craftsmanship and natural materials, ideal for bungalows.3. Glass OptionsClear Glass: Offers unobstructed views and optimal light.Frosted Glass: Provides privacy while allowing light to go through.Textured Glass: Adds an artistic touch while still keeping a degree of privacy.Setup Considerations

Are French doors with sidelights energy efficient?
Yes, modern-day French doors with sidelights can be energy-efficient, especially those with double or triple glazing and good insulation properties.
2. What is the typical expense of French doors with sidelights?
Costs can vary considerably depending on materials and personalization alternatives, but you can anticipate to pay anywhere from ₤ 1,000 to ₤ 5,000 or more, including installation.
3. Can I set up French doors with sidelights myself?
While it is possible, professional setup is advised for optimum fit, energy efficiency, and weatherproofing.
4. What styles of homes gain from French doors with sidelights?
These doors match a range of architectural designs, consisting of standard, contemporary, home, and Mediterranean homes.
